Riley Burruss’ ‘Next Gen NYC’ Co-Star Brooks Marks Defends Her After Racial Undertones On The Show: ‘Microaggressions Are Never Okay’
“Next Gen NYC” star Brooks Marks—son of “Real Housewives of Salt Lake City” alum Meredith Marks—defends Riley Burruss amid criticism over racial undertones. “I’m proud of Riley for speaking up,” he said. “Microaggressions are never okay…these conversations are a chance to listen, learn… I’m grateful for this platform and committed to using it to stand for what’s right.”
